What is Dead Wooding?

Dead wooding is an arboricultural technique that involves the careful removal of dead, dying, or diseased branches from a tree. These branches, often referred to as "deadwood," can pose various risks to the tree's health and the safety of its surroundings.

Why is Dead Wooding Necessary?

1. Enhanced Tree Health:

Dead wooding promotes the overall health of a tree by eliminating decaying branches that could harbor diseases or pests. This, in turn, encourages new and healthy growth.

2. Reduced Safety Risks:

Dead branches can become brittle and pose a hazard as they may fall unexpectedly, especially during storms or high winds. Dead wooding helps mitigate these risks, ensuring a safer environment for your property.

3. Aesthetic Improvement:

Beyond safety concerns, dead wooding contributes to the aesthetic appeal of your landscape. It provides a cleaner and more polished look, allowing your trees to flourish and stand out.

4. Preserving Tree Structure:

Removing deadwood helps maintain the structural integrity of a tree. This is particularly crucial for mature trees, preventing the risk of limb failure and ensuring a well-balanced canopy.

The Dead Wooding Process:

  1. Assessment and Identification:
  2. A certified arborist begins by assessing the tree's condition, identifying dead or decaying branches.
  3. Strategic Removal:
  4. Using specialized tools, dead wooding involves the precise removal of targeted branches. This process is carried out with utmost care to minimize impact on the tree.
  5. Clean-Up:
  6. Once the dead wooding process is complete, debris is carefully removed, leaving your property neat and free from potential hazards.

When is the Best Time for Dead Wooding?

Dead wooding can be performed throughout the year, but it is often recommended during the dormant season (late autumn to early spring) when the tree is less stressed. This ensures a quicker recovery and minimal impact on the tree's growth.
